Indie Moet Vrij! (The Indies Must Be Freed) , 1944
Colour lithograph, signed "Pat Keely" and dated in image upper left, 74.5 x 49.1cm. Repaired tears to old pinholes and edges, minor crinkles and foxing. Linen-backed.
Text in Dutch and English continues "Werkt en vecht ervoor! (Work and fight for it!). Printed in England by James Haworth & Brother Ltd, London. Uitage RVD no. 4 C4." Held in IWM, and AWM with the comment "Published by the Dutch Government in exile in London. It was distributed in the liberated south of the Netherlands to encourage its citizens in the war effort."
Patrick (Patou) Cokayne Keely (d.1970) was a British graphic artist known for his WWII posters for the Ministry of Information along with strongly stylised commercial posters. Ref: Wiki.
